Isle Royale is known for its great amount of moose and wolves. They have been studied for over five years! The two organisms are the longest ever studied predator-pray system in the world. During the 1990's, both species population decreased dramatically due to diseases and cold winters. Wolves have since then, inbred, and their size has increased. Despite that, moose population is still low. Isle Royale is also home to a number of plants including various berry bushes to different types of moss.
